  • Which airlines fly most frequently to the United Arab Emirates?

    Middle East and United Arab Emirates are connected by different airlines. The airlines that fly that route the most regularly are Emirates (666 flights per week), flydubai (581 flights per week), and Etihad Airways (415 flights per week).

  • How many airports are there in the United Arab Emirates?

    There are 7 airports in the United Arab Emirates. The busiest airport is Dubai Airport (DXB), with 59% of all flights arriving there.

  • Which is the cheapest airport to fly into in the United Arab Emirates?

    Prices will differ depending on the departure airport, but generally, the cheapest airport to fly to in the United Arab Emirates is Dubai Al Maktoum Intl Airport (DWC), with an average flight price of AED 379.

  • What is the cheapest flight to the United Arab Emirates?

    The cheapest ticket to the United Arab Emirates from Middle East found in the last 72 hours was to Sharjah, at AED 171 return. The most popular route is Amman (AMM) to Dubai (DXB) and the cheapest return airline ticket found on this route in the last 72 hours was AED 218.

  • What is the cheapest month to fly from Middle East to the United Arab Emirates?

    The cheapest month for flights from Middle East to the United Arab Emirates is September, when tickets cost AED 635 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are March and January, when the average cost of round-trip tickets is AED 1,021 and AED 947 respectively.

  • How many cities have direct flights to the United Arab Emirates?

    From Middle East, there are direct flights to the United Arab Emirates from 34 cities. The city with the most direct flights is Riyadh, with 729 direct flights each week.

  • How many direct flights to the United Arab Emirates are there each day?

    There are around 611 direct flights from within Middle East to the United Arab Emirates every day. Most flights (28%) depart in the afternoon.

  • How many direct flights to the United Arab Emirates are there each week?

    Each week there are around 4,272 direct flights from within Middle East to the United Arab Emirates. The most common day for departures is Sunday, with 16% of flights taking off on this day.

  • How long is the flight to the United Arab Emirates?

    An average direct flight from Middle East to the United Arab Emirates takes 3h 03m, covering a distance of 1982 km. The shortest route is Doha (DOH) to Abu Dhabi (AUH) with an average flight time of 1h 00m.

  • How many long-haul flights are there to the United Arab Emirates each week?

    There aren’t any long-haul (6-12 hour flight duration) or medium-haul (3-6 hour flight duration) flights to the United Arab Emirates. Instead, there are 4,272 short-haul flights (up to 3 hour flight duration), with the most arriving from Riyadh.

  • What are the most popular destinations in the United Arab Emirates?

    Based on KAYAK flight searches, the most popular destination is Dubai (69% of total searches to the United Arab Emirates). The next most popular destinations are Sharjah (19%) and Abu Dhabi (12%). Searches for flights to Ras Al Khaimah (0%) and to Al Ain (0%) are also popular.
